NMWA releases the Sonya Clark exhibition catalogue

Last week, the National Museum of Women in the Arts opened an exhibition of art by Sonya Clark. It’s the first survey show in Clark’s 25-year career, and features mixed-media works that address race and visibility, explore Blackness, and redress history. Studio A had the honor of designing the exhibition catalogue, and we look forward to seeing the art in person soon. Moving and meaningful, “Sonya Clark: Tatter, Bristle, and Mend” is on exhibit until May 31.
